Is it possible in a Matrix to show 2 measures next to eachother by Year? (screenshot)

Hi

 

Is there a way to show all values of one measure by Year, and next to it, show all the values of a second measure by Year?

In Excel Pivottables you can easily do that but I'm not sure this is possible in Power BI? I think you need to create 12 measures and add measures every year?

Not sure you can make the same easily in Power BI.  One approach might be two make two identical matrix visuals with the two measures and then overlap the first over the row labels on the second (using the selection pane on the View tab to get the display order right).
